1.BACKGROUND**
CARE Somalia has adopted a program approach that is focusing on achieving a specific impact on a particular vulnerable population group over a 10 to 15-year period. The approach involves developing theories of change and program strategies for specific impact groups who have been carefully identified and selected based on in-depth situational analysis. One of the country office impact group is urban youth who are in the age bracket 15-29 years, out of school and/or socially marginalized. Through strategic alliances and increased policy advocacy, CARE’s Urban youth program will contribute to lasting change in the lives of these most impoverished and marginalized youth. At present the focus of much of the work with urban youth is on education, inclusive governance and livelihoods with an emphasis on TVET. The aim of this project will be to work with these youths to address underlying causes of poverty, vulnerability and marginalization that affect them.
